## Authentication

Heads up: the nightly reindex job (`reindex_nightly.py`) talks to the Lanternfish search cluster, and that cluster won't accept anonymous writes anymore — we locked it down last sprint. The job now authenticates as the `reindex-runner` service identity against Corvid Gateway, and the token is injected via the `LF_INDEX_TOKEN` env var in the scheduler config. Nothing clever going on, just a bearer header on every batch request. For review purposes, the staging credential currently in use is listed below.

service key, kadug-kadup: kto15_rN23XLAYImmZgrJ

Runbook: Givewell-style receipt mailer (Kindpost service). New team members: receipts are generated nightly and queued per campaign. If the queue backs up, check template rendering errors before touching SMTP settings. Never re-run a batch without clearing the dedupe table, or donors get duplicate receipts. The mailer reads its settings at startup from the following configuration.

deployment values, yadug-bawif:
[framir]
team = pelox
access_code = ac_a38ab2
owner = tamion.julael
host = framir.tolvaqlabs.test
port = 11211
peer = tammir.zemvargrid.local
salt = 2215ef03
pin = 1541

## Changelog — Tilefetch 2.4: changed defaults

For new team members: Tilefetch 2.4 changes the prefetcher's default behavior. Viewport-edge prefetching now extends two tile rings instead of one, and the zoom-ahead cache is enabled by default, which increases memory use modestly but cuts pan latency noticeably. After upgrading, fresh installs will start with the following configuration.

service settings:
PRAIX_LOG_LEVEL=error
PRAIX_METRICS_HOST=metrics.praix.qorvelcorp.corp
PRAIX_POOL_SIZE=16

Runbook 4.2 — Office move, Phase B (Warehouse shift lead)

All crates from the Fenwright second floor arrive on pallets marked FW-B. Verify seal tags against the manifest before racking, and quarantine any crate with a broken seal in bay 7. The finance cabinet travels separately under escort. At the courier hand-over, the following instruction applies.

courier memo of yawep-yafog: the pramir ulaix courier leaves the ulavan aldix frair zorok oliiel joreth rusdor fenvan ledger at gate 1305 under passcode 514738